“Turn back, turn back, thou pretty bride,
Within this house thou must not abide.
For here do evil things betide.”
― Jacob Grimm


If you want me to tell you that the world is all sunshine and rainbows, that people are all you have to worry about, that there isn't anything that goes bump in the night, then you should stop listening. Now. You know that feeling when you know you're all alone at night, but there is that little, tiny, minuscule shred of primordial fear that violently whispers: "There's something out there"? Well, I hunt those things. My entire family does, actually, going way back to my several-times-over great grandfather. We hunt the things that go bump in the night, and we're damn good at it. We're what monsters check the closet for before sliding under the covers at night.

If you knew all the things that slither and crawl on the underbelly of the world, you'd never sleep another night in your life. Don't worry though, My family will take care of it.

"Monsters" have been here a long time. Some stalked our ancestors while we were still trying the whole live-in-caves-thing. Others came from us sticking our noses where they didn't belong. For most of human history, we stayed afraid of the "unknown". The woods were just crawling with goblins and ghouls. That was, of course, until the Grimms rocked up on the scene. Two brothers, Wilhelm and Jacob Grimm, the latter being my ancestor, decided to take the fight to the freaks directly. They traveled all over Germany and Europe going toe-to-toe with creatures born straight out of nightmares. They even wrote some of the stories down and published them after some healthy doses of sanitization. In one of their many exploits, they came across a coven of witches that they managed to dispatch without much difficulty, but not before being afflicted with a blood curse. The Curse didn't turn out exactly like the witches intended...

Then things got even worse for monsters when my great-grandfather came to the United States. Decades of German resourcefulness and ingenuity mixed with American brawn and monsters everywhere just slightly pissed themselves. My family continued the Grimm legacy, passing down our knowledge of the supernatural, and the Grimm Curse. Most of the members of my family were sent to an early grave, but my father stayed alive long enough to see me and my siblings, and a few of my cousins, grow old enough to take up the mantle of Grimm.

The Curse

The Curse that Wilhelm and Jacob Grimm were afflicted with marked them and their blood descendants for all eternity. Monsters are drawn to those of the Grimm bloodline. It takes either a lot of fear or self-control for a monster to refrain from attacking a Grimm on sight. But, the curse had some... beneficial side effects.

In the vicinity of a living monster, you grow extremely strong and agile, capable of outperforming Olympic athletes helps when you're dodging the claws of a werewolf. Your senes also sharpen, your sense of smell becomes comparable to a bloodhound, and your other senes also grow to superhuman levels.

You can sense the recent presence of monsters, and even track them to some degree.

All of this comes with downsides, though. You grow extremely tired after your powers are triggered, and you need to eat a lot to compensate for the spent calories. Other common side effects include migraines and nosebleeds. Your Grimm blood does give you a greater resistance to monster born poisons, toxins, and other creature powers. Vampire or werewolf bites won't necessarily turn you, but they can if they occur in rapid succession.

Most Grimms carry monster claws or other remains wrapped up in leather pouches so they can activate their powers at will (contact with supernatural remains triggers powers, while merely being close to them do not. If you are near a live monster, though, your powers will want to activate, but you can repress them, although not forever).
